Panigrahi, in [DSBP2024] Exact search algorithm to factorize large biprimes and a triprime on IBM quantum computer (arXiv:1805.10478, 2024) … Shor's algorithm is a quantum computer algorithm for finding the prime factors of an integer. It was developed in 1994 by the American mathematician Peter Shor. On a quantum computer, to factor an integer , Shor's algorithm runs in polylogarithmic time, meaning the time taken is polynomial in , the size of the integer given as input. Step 1: ... thrasher merchandiseNettet4. mar. 2016 · This latest work was done by Thomas Monz and colleagues at the University of Innsbruck, and Isaac Chuang and team at the Massachusetts Institute of Technology. Using five trapped calcium-40 ions as qubits, the collaboration used Kitaev’s version of Shor’s algorithm to factor the number 15.
